Italian 10 Cent Euro Coin
Country of Origin: Italy
Year of Issue: 2002
Denomination: 10 Euro Cents
Composition: Nordic gold (89% copper, 5% aluminium, 5% zinc, and 1% tin)

Brief Description
The obverse features the face of Venus, a detail from Sandro Botticelli\'s masterpiece \'The Birth of Venus\'. It includes the year 2002, the monogram of the Italian Republic (RI), and 12 stars of the European Union around the edge.
Historical Significance
This coin was part of the initial release of the Euro currency in 2002. Each EU member state designs its own national side; Italy chose famous works of art to represent its cultural heritage. Botticelli\'s Venus reflects the Italian Renaissance.

Care Instructions
To preserve the coin, handle it by the edges to avoid transferring fingerprints and oils. Store in a cool, dry place within a PVC-free holder or capsule. Do not clean with abrasive chemicals as this can permanently damage the surface and reduce collector value.
